Overview of Methyl Hydrogenated Rosinate

Methyl Hydrogenated Rosinate, a key ingredient in the manufacturing market, is a derivative of rosin obtained from the oleoresin of pine trees. It is a versatile compound known for its adhesive properties and is widely used in various industrial applications. The chemical structure of Methyl Hydrogenated Rosinate consists of a mixture of esters, making it a valuable component in the formulation of adhesives, coatings, and printing inks.

Moreover, Methyl Hydrogenated Rosinate offers excellent temperature resistance and tackiness, making it suitable for a wide range of applications. It is often utilized as a tackifier in hot melt adhesives and sealants, providing enhanced adhesive strength and bonding properties. Due to its ability to improve cohesion and adhesion in formulations, Methyl Hydrogenated Rosinate plays a crucial role in the development of high-performance industrial products.

Applications of Methyl Hydrogenated Rosinate in Various Industries

Methyl hydrogenated rosinates find extensive utilization across a spectrum of industries, showcasing their versatility and utility. In the adhesive market, these compounds serve as crucial components in hot melt adhesives, contributing to enhanced adhesion properties and durability. Their presence in the cosmetics sector is notable, where they function as key ingredients in various skincare and haircare products, owing to their emollient and stabilizing characteristics.

Moreover, the food and beverage market benefits from the applications of methyl hydrogenated rosinates as emulsifiers and stabilizers in food processing, ensuring product consistency and quality. Additionally, in the pharmaceutical market, these compounds serve as excipients in drug formulations, assisting in the uniform distribution of active pharmaceutical ingredients. Their role in the packaging market is significant, where they are employed as coatings for food packaging materials, providing a protective barrier and extending the shelf life of packaged products.

Key Players in the Methyl Hydrogenated Rosinate Market

Several key players dominate the methyl hydrogenated rosin market, each making significant contributions to the market. Companies like Eastman Chemical Company, Arakawa Chemical Industries, and Arizona Chemical Company are leading suppliers of methyl hydrogenated rosin products. These companies have established themselves as key players due to their strong market presence, extensive distribution networks, and ongoing research and development efforts to enhance product quality.

Furthermore, Chemical market giants such as Kraton Corporation, Harima Chemicals Group, and DRT are also prominent players in the methyl hydrogenated rosin market. Their expertise in manufacturing high-quality chemicals and continuous innovation in product formulations have solidified their positions in the market.
